The sustainability movement faces a pivotal moment. Climate, biodiversity, poverty, and inequality are being treated as competing priorities — when in truth, they are different expressions of the same systemic failure.
This session challenges that false trade-off. Bringing together leading scientists, advocates, and communicators, we will explore what a genuinely just world on a safe planet looks like — and why it is not a sacrifice, but the most compelling vision for prosperity, resilience, and belonging in the 21st century.
Programme
Part 1: Panel discussion on escaping the false trade-off between sustainability and economic security — and articulating a positive, pluralistic vision.
Part 2: Table discussions on building connective tissue across silos, sectors, and scales — with concrete commitments shared in a closing plenary.
Speakers: (more to be announced soon)
Sandrine Dixson-Declève (Earth4All)
Naoko Ishii (Center for Global Commons, University of Tokyo)
Laura Pereira (Earth Commission)
Jeremy Oppenheim (Systemiq)
Lucy Stone (Climate Spring)
